FUNCTIONAL ENDOSCOPIC SINUS SURGERY FOR CONTACT POINT RHINOGENIC HEADACHE
Emad Ahmed El Assal;
Abstract
The headache was commonly dull aching in character and sometimes pulsating. It was referred most commonly to one side of the head with the orbit, the frontal and temporal areas were the predominant referral sites. It may occur without any nasal symptoms.
